  隆昌县高考英语一轮复习完形填空专练1

  (2017·马鞍山市高中毕业班第一次教学质量检测)

  A certain good woman one day said something that hurt her best friend of many years.She__1__immediately and would have done anything to have taken the words back.__2__she said hurt the friend so much that this good woman was herself hurt__3__the pain she caused.__4__to cancel what she had done,she went to an older,wiser woman in the village,explained her situation,and asked for__5__.

  Listening to her,the older woman__6__the younger woman’s distress and knew she must help her.She also knew she could never__7__her pain,but she could teach.She knew the__8__would depend only on the character of the younger woman.She said,“Tonight,take your best feather pillows and put a single feather on the doorstep of each house in the town__9__the sun rises.”

  The young woman hurried__10__to prepare for her chore,even though the feather pillows were very__11__to her.All night long,she labored alone in the cold.Finally the sky was getting__12__,she placed the last feather on the steps of the last house.Just as the sun rose,she returned to__13__.

  “Now,” said the wise woman,“Go back and__14__your pillows with the feather you have put on the steps.Then everything will be__15__it was before.”

  “You know that’s__16__!The wind blew away each feather as fast as I placed them on the__17__!” The younger woman was surprised.

  “That’s true,” said the older woman.“Never forget.Each of your__18__is like a feather in the wind.Once spoken,no amount of effort,__19__how heartfelt or sincere,they can never return to your mouth.Choose your words well and__20__them most of all in the presence of those you love.”

  语篇解读 本文是一篇记叙文。一个善良的女人说了一些话伤害了她最好的朋友,她话一出口就后悔了。她的话伤害朋友如此之深,以至于这个善良的女人为自己给朋友造成痛苦而伤心不已。这个故事告诉我们:覆水难收。所以在别人面前尤其是我们珍爱的人面前最好注意自己的言辞。

  1.解析: 考查动词辨析。由下文语境可知,她话一出口就后悔了。regret意为“后悔”,符合语境。

  答案: C

  2.解析: 考查名词性从句的引导词。空格处引导主语从句,且主语从句中缺少动词say的宾语,所以用what引导。

  答案: D

  3.解析: 考查介词辨析。这个善良的女人为自己给朋友造成痛苦而伤心不已。for意为“因为”,符合语境。

  答案: A

  4.解析: 考查介词短语辨析。句意为:为了努力消除她所做的一切,她去找村子里年长的、聪明的女人。in an effort to do sth.意为“试图做某事”,符合语境。

  答案: B

  5.解析: 考查名词辨析。根据第二段第一句话中“she must help her...she could teach”可知,她来是寻求建议的。ask for advice意为“请求建议”。

  答案: C

  6.解析: 考查动词辨析。

  句意为:听着年轻女人的述说,这位老妇人感觉到了她的忧伤,并且知道得帮助她。sense意为“感觉到”,符合语境。

  答案: A

  7.解析: 考查动词辨析。句意为:老妇人知道她不可能减轻她的伤痛,但可以让她从中吸取教训。relieve意为“减轻”,符合语境。

  答案: C

  8.解析: 考查名词辨析。句意为:她明白事情的结果只能是取决于她的性格。outcome意为“结果,结局”,符合语境。

  答案: B

  9.解析: 考查连词辨析。句意为:她说:“今晚,拆开你最好的羽毛枕头,在太阳升起之前,在本镇每家的门前的台阶上放一根羽毛。”由下文语境可知,此处指在太阳升起之前,故选D项。

  答案: D

  10.解析: 考查副词辨析。句意为:年轻女人匆匆赶回家准备这件事。

  答案: A

  11.解析: 考查形容词辨析。由上文“take your best feather pillows...”可知,这些枕头是她非常心爱的。

  答案: D

  12.解析: 考查动词辨析。由上文可知,她是在晚上将羽毛放在每家的台阶上,由此可推出此处指天快亮了。

  答案: A

  13.解析: 考查名词辨析。由下文她和老妇人的对话可知,她在太阳升起时回到老妇人那里。

  答案: B

  14.解析: 考查动词辨析。句意为:回去再用你放在每家台阶上的羽毛把枕头填满。refill...with...意为“重新填满”,符合语境。

  答案: C

  15.解析: 考查词汇辨析。句意为:然后,一切事情将会像以前一样。as意为“像……一样,依照”,符合语境。

  答案: D

  16.解析: 考查形容词辨析。由下文语境可知,羽毛被风吹走了,再将羽毛填到枕头里是不可能的。impossible意为“不可能的”,符合语境。

  答案: A

  17.解析: 考查动词辨析。句意为:我把羽毛一放在台阶上,风就把它们吹跑了!根据句意以及第二段最后一句话中的“doorstep”提示可知,应选B项。

  答案: B

  18.解析: 考查名词辨析。句意为:你要永远记住,你的每句话就像是风中的羽毛,覆水难收。本文中提到这个善良的女人用话语伤害了她的好友,且由下文“Once spoken...they can never return to your mouth.”提示可知应选C项。

  答案: C

  19.解析: 考查形容词辨析。句意为:一旦话已说出,尽管你的愿望是如何真心、如何诚意,但所说的话如泼水不可收回。regardless意为“不管,不顾”,符合语境。

  答案: B

  20.解析: 考查动词辨析。句意为:在那些为你所爱的人面前,适当选择并且控制你的言辞。guard意为“控制;使(言辞等)谨慎”,符合语境。
